Show Funeral Friday in Provo for Ethelyn S. Case Funeral services will be conducted con-ducted Friday at 11 a.m., in Berg Mortuary, Provo, for Mrs. Ethelyn Swenson Case, 62, who died Tuesday of a heart sail-ment sail-ment at a Provo hospital. Friends may call at the Mortuary Mor-tuary this evening from 6 to 8 p.m., and Friday, before the services. Burial will be in Provo cemetery. Mrs. Case was born in Springville, Jan. 26, 1900, a daughter of Francis Oscar and Thoda Peterson Swenson. She was married to F. Arthur Ar-thur Case, Oct. 4. 1917 at Blackfot, Idaho. She lived in Springville during dur-ing her early life, attending schools in this pity and also spent the greater portion of her married life here, moving to Provo in 1949. She was a member of the LDS church. Surviving besides her husband, hus-band, are two daughters, Mrs. Bert (Klell) Child of Springville Spring-ville and Mrs. Fred (Laverne) Cunningham of Provo; three grandchildren and one sister, Mrs. Lewis (Lima) Allred of Bell Gardens, Calif. |
